Qualifications: This internship requires a passion for pop culture. In order to facilitate the learning experience, the candidate should be seeking a career in print, broadcast, or online journalism. Candidates should be self-motivated, able to multi-task, have a good attitude, and be able to function well in an environment with short deadlines and quick turnaround projects. Turner Broadcasting System, Inc. and its subsidiaries are Equal Opportunity Employers.

Duties: Turner’s Students @ Work Internships are paid at minimum-wage and structured to last approximately 12 weeks after the Spring 2012 school semester ends. Generally interns will work from June 4th through August 10th. Resume and Cover Letter are required. Students should have a strong academic record (GPA 3.0 or above strongly preferred). Students must have completed their sophomore year in college prior to the start of the internship. In addition, students may not have graduated college or graduate school prior to the start of the internship. Students seeking college credit are strongly encouraged to apply. Note to International Students: All international students will be required to provide documentation of proper visa paperwork prior to the beginning of the internship if accepted to the program.
